Sexual

see synonyms of sexual

Adjective

1. sexual

of or relating to or characterized by sexuality

Example Sentences:
'sexual orientation'
'sexual distinctions'

2. sexual

having or involving sex

Example Sentences:
'sexual reproduction'
'sexual spores'

3. intimate, sexual

involved in a sexual relationship

Example Sentences:
'the intimate (or sexual) relations between husband and wife'
'she had been intimate with many men'
'he touched her intimate parts'

Sexual

see synonyms of sexual
adj.
1. Relating to, involving, or characteristic of sex or sexuality, or the sex organs and their functions: sexual partners; sexual fantasies; sexual dysfunction.
2. Relating to the sexes or to gender: sexual politics.
3.
a. Relating to, involving, or being reproduction characterized by the union of male and female gametes.
b. Able to reproduce in this way; fertile.
